## Artifact signing — Squatterhawk scanner

For this week's sync: Squatterhawk now scans our internal registry for typo-squatting packages (think "lodashh" style lookalikes) before every release train. Flagged packages block the pipeline until a human clears them. Because the scanner itself ships as a signed artifact, its releases must be verified too — otherwise it's turtles all the way down. Verify scanner builds against the key below.

deploy key for kajof-fajop: bky6_gDHw9Q

## Runbook: PortionCraft Scaling Calculator

Before reviewing, note that PortionCraft accepts user-supplied ingredient lists and scaling factors, so input validation is the primary concern. All arithmetic runs server-side with bounded precision to prevent overflow abuse, and uploaded recipe files are parsed in a sandboxed worker. The validation rules, sandbox configuration, and prior audit findings are consolidated on the internal security page.

operations page: https://confluence.tolvaqsys.corp/spaces/pages/pages/6e787158f507

## Handover: Cinderpost Bloom Filter

Handing off the bloom filter fronting the Cinderpost KV store. False-positive rate crept up after last week's key influx; I resized the bit array and bumped hash count, but haven't validated under peak load. Please hold the release until the soak test finishes. The filter currently runs with these settings.

deployment values, kajep-kageg:
[praix]
host = praix.paliqcorp.corp
user = praix_svc
database = praix_prod

Finance Review Summary — Logistics Provider Change

Sales leads: Marbeck Goods will transition fulfilment from Craylan Freight to Novarro Logistics next quarter. Modelled savings are roughly 9% of distribution cost, with improved delivery reliability in the Westholm corridor. Expect brief handover delays; advise customers accordingly. The confidential note below sets out the related business plans.

internal memo for kawip-hadug: Headcount on the Wenwyn team goes from 7 to 140 by the end of January. Gross margin on Wenwyn came in at 20 percent against a plan of 15 percent.